Transaction 58a2d3d5b7b23c0f38c3765ab64380668ab8a9b8563e04476b96eb4a34db3e75

1 Input
2 Outputs
  • 58a2d3d5b7b23c0f38c3765ab64380668ab8a9b8563e04476b96eb4a34db3e75:0
  • value  24403201
    address  3EZbHMeNdPJg5shsxz6FyNv6Bk9SThmPMG
  • 58a2d3d5b7b23c0f38c3765ab64380668ab8a9b8563e04476b96eb4a34db3e75:1
  • value  580452
    address  17dbNyWbr4ZmLsWJAoWak3nSj8JvrXMkR3